SENTIMENT ANALYSIS IN SOCIAL MEDIA USING MULTI-MODAL DATA FUSION TECHNIQUES
Abstract
In recent years, with the popularity of social media, users are increasingly keen to express their feelings and opinions in the form of pictures and text, which makes multimodal data with text and pictures the con tent type with the most growth. The bulk of information written on the social media by users is clearly sentimental in nature and multimodal sentiment analysis has emerged as a vital area of study. Receiving the text and image feature separately then integrating them to classify the sentiment has been the main focus of previous studies on multimodal sentiment analysis. These researches tend to overlook the interrelationship between text and images. Thus, the new model of multimodal sentiment analysis is suggested in this paper. The model initially removes noise interference in text related information and cleanses more significant image features. After that, under the feature-fusion step which is founded on the attention mechanism, the text and images teach the inner features of each other with the help of symmetry. Then the fusion features are implemented on sentiment classification problems. The proposed model proves to be effective as evident in the experimental findings of the two popular multimodal sentiment datasets.
